Jhargaon at a glance

Jhargaon is a village of 530 people in 95 households (Census 2011) in Satgawan block, Koderma district, Jharkhand, the 51st-largest of 144 villages in Satgawan block. Literacy is 29%, 18 points below the block average of 47% and the sex ratio is 886 women per 1,000 men. The pincode is 825132, served by Satgawan post office; the LGD village code is 349506. The sarpanch is MANTU CHAUDHARY, and the village votes in Jamua assembly constituency, represented by MLA Manju Kumari. The population is estimated at 2,552 in 2026, up 382% since the 2011 Census.
